Title: Edwin A. Harcourt: Pioneering Innovations in Electronic Design

Introduction

Edwin A. Harcourt, based in Townsend, MA, has made significant contributions to the field of electronic design through his innovative patents. With a total of two patents credited to his name, Harcourt's work primarily focuses on enhancing simulation methods for mixed-language circuit designs and performance modeling of electronic systems.

Latest Patents

Harcourt's latest patents include a revolutionary "Method and System for Simulation of Mixed-Language Circuit Designs." This patent discloses a method wherein an object-oriented language module is natively instantiated within a hardware description language-based design, alongside the reverse configuration. Additionally, his patent for the "Method and System for Performance Level Modeling and Simulation of Electronic Systems Having Both Hardware and Software Elements" significantly enhances the evaluation process of electronic systems, allowing for streamlined implementation and testing of various architectural designs.
